#include <stdio.h>
int main() {
int i;
for(i = 0; i < 10; i++) {
printf("The value of i is: %d\n", i);
}
return 0;
}
This code snippet demonstrates a basic for loop in C. The loop starts with the initialization statement int i;
, which declares and initializes the loop control variable i
to 0.
The loop continues as long as the condition i < 10
is true. On each iteration, the loop body is executed, which in this case is a single statement that prints the value of i
using the printf
function.
After each iteration, the update statement i++
increments the value of i
by 1. This ensures that the loop eventually terminates when the condition i < 10
becomes false.
The output of this code will be the numbers 0 to 9, each on a new line.
